Rail Mounted Trucks: An Overview

Rail mounted trucks are integral components in the material handling industry, designed to facilitate the movement and management of goods within a variety of settings. These trucks are typically mounted on rails, allowing for smooth and precise transportation of materials, especially in repetitive or linear paths.

Types and Applications

There are several types of rail mounted trucks, each serving specific applications. Some are tailored for heavy-duty lifting, suitable for industrial environments, while others are designed for lighter tasks. Their applications range from warehouse inventory management to serving production lines and aiding in the efficient loading and unloading of freight.

Features and Materials

The construction of rail mounted trucks involves robust materials capable of withstanding the rigors of industrial use. Features may include advanced control systems for precision handling, durable wheels for rail movement, and ergonomic designs to enhance operator safety and efficiency.

Advantages of Rail Mounted Trucks

Utilizing rail mounted trucks in material handling operations offers numerous advantages. Their rail-based movement ensures consistent and reliable handling, reducing the risk of accidents and material damage. Moreover, these trucks can significantly improve operational throughput by streamlining the movement of goods.

Selection Considerations

When selecting a rail mounted truck, it is crucial to consider the specific needs of your operation, such as load capacity, rail design compatibility, and the type of materials to be handled. It is also important to evaluate the truck's power source, choosing between electric models for cleaner operations or other types depending on the application's requirements.

Integrating Rail Mounted Trucks into Logistics

Incorporating rail mounted trucks into a logistics strategy can lead to enhanced efficiency and productivity. They are particularly beneficial in settings where goods need to be moved consistently along the same path, such as between production lines or within storage facilities.
